Output 2c538d7cf05a989ba9adc8a9505df5248ae53280f5999709c4cc7ae215ae21d9:0

value
739689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aecbbe97933daba905f9b48c67453c07e5b8b004 OP_EQUAL
address
3HdFaLaL18VdWjfXeyeP2xW8Sa4N1Fc9Qc
transaction
2c538d7cf05a989ba9adc8a9505df5248ae53280f5999709c4cc7ae215ae21d9
spent
true